Life is a roller coaster of up and down moments but it’s up to you how you handle its curveballs, blessings, and roadblocks that come across your roadmap of life. It’s your movie screen of memories that you constantly take photos of to look back on and remember. It’s a video full of highlights, main events, and everything in between to replay in your mind. You only have this one life to make the most of it. There may not be a guide book on how to do that but you can certainly leave a few footprints of advice for others to follow.

Below are a few consejos — and life advice — I hope to inspire in my daughter as she travels along with on her own roadmap of life.

Live in the Moment

Photo by Brett Jordan on Unsplash

Don’t be in such a hurry to grow up that you forget to live in the moments in time. When I was young, all I wanted was to be on my own and in my own place. Never did I imagine how much I would miss watching my mom cook or going out with my friends who I might never spend time with in the same care-free way. When you’re young you think you have forever but in reality, in the blink of an eye, you’re the adult. Take in those moments. Get lost in them and make them last because once that day ends, they will only exist in the chapters of your memories.

Own Who You Are

Photo by Sofia Guaico on Unsplash

In today’s society, it is easy to get caught up with trying to look like someone else, be like someone else that we forget we are a masterpiece just the way we are! Remember you are in competition with no one, and the only race to run is your own. If you want to improve anything, improve on who you were yesterday. Own your personality, own your laughter, own your scars, and own your authentic self because in reality there is no one out there like you in this world, and that is what makes you one-of-a-kind.

Just as you lay out a road map for your life, it is important to lay out a road map for your health so you can be strong and healthier well into your golden years. You have to learn to eat differently as you get older. Everything in moderation. That pizza at midnight or cookies for dessert won’t be as welcoming to your body. Start a love affair with exercise early on, and it won’t come as such a shock to keep it up as you grow older. I’ve seen women in their 60’s striking yoga poses that young girls do in their 20’s. You only have this one body. Take care of it and it will take care of you.

Spend Time with Your Parents

Photo by Gustavo Alves on Unsplash

This is important to remember because as you’re getting older, so are your parents. My biggest regret is not spending more time pampering my mom before her time was gone. You say tomorrow we will do that but one day tomorrow will be too late. Take trips together, have a spa day, cook dinner together and share old family recipes but create one of kind lasting memories that no one, including death, can take from you. Take silly photos just because. Hug them every chance you get and say I love you every single day. Those memories are all you will have to reflect back on your journey with them.
